Wiktionary

FRAGILE, adjective. Easily broken or destroyed, and thus often of subtle or intricate structure.
FRAGILE X, noun. (informal) Fragile X syndrome.
FRAGILE X SYNDROME, noun. A particular, genetic syndrome, caused by the excessive repetition of a particular trinucleotide.

Dictionary definition

FRAGILE, adjective. Easily broken or damaged or destroyed; "a kite too delicate to fly safely"; "fragile porcelain plates"; "fragile old bones"; "a frail craft".
FRAGILE, adjective. Vulnerably delicate; "she has the fragile beauty of youth".
FRAGILE, adjective. Lacking substance or significance; "slight evidence"; "a tenuous argument"; "a thin plot"; a fragile claim to fame".
